Top Skin Care Products to Buy in Seoul


1. Hydrating Toners and Essences


Hydration is the foundation of any good skin care routine. Korean toners and essences are designed to prep your skin for better absorption of later products. Look for:


  • Laneige Water Bank Essence: Known for deep hydration using mineral-rich water and green tea extracts.

  • Cosrx Advanced Snail 96 Mucin Power Essence: Contains snail mucin to repair and soothe skin, ideal for sensitive or acne-prone skin.


These products help maintain moisture balance and improve skin texture.


2. Sheet Masks


Sheet masks are a K-Beauty staple and a quick way to boost your skin’s health. Seoul offers a huge variety with different benefits:


  • Mediheal N.M.F Aquaring Ampoule Mask: Great for intense hydration and calming irritated skin.

  • Innisfree My Real Squeeze Masks: Made with natural ingredients like green tea, aloe, and manuka honey, perfect for targeting specific concerns.


You can find these masks in convenience stores, beauty shops, and even street markets.


3. Sunscreens with Lightweight Formulas


Sun protection is crucial, and Korean sunscreens are famous for their light, non-greasy feel. Some popular picks include:


  • Etude House Sunprise Mild Airy Finish SPF50+: Offers strong protection without leaving a white cast.

  • Missha All Around Safe Block Essence Sun Milk: Combines moisturizing ingredients with broad-spectrum UV protection.

  • Sponuva PDRN Active Suncream Pro SPF 50+: Professional Sunscreen combining waterproof and transfer proof actions, hydration, is non-sticky, and leaves the skin glowy instead of white and oily.


These sunscreens layer well under makeup and keep your skin comfortable all day.


4. Cleansing Balms and Oils


Double cleansing is a key step in K-Beauty routines. Cleansing balms and oils dissolve makeup and impurities without stripping skin:


  • Banila Co Clean It Zero Cleansing Balm: A cult favorite that melts away makeup and leaves skin soft.

  • The Face Shop Rice Water Bright Light Cleansing Oil: Contains rice water to brighten and cleanse gently.


These products make removing sunscreen and makeup easier and more effective.


5. Lightweight Moisturizers and Sleeping Packs


Moisturizers in Seoul often focus on hydration without heaviness. Sleeping packs are overnight treatments that lock in moisture:


  • Belif The True Cream Aqua Bomb: A gel-cream that refreshes and hydrates oily or combination skin.

  • Laneige Water Sleeping Mask: A popular overnight mask that revitalizes tired skin while you sleep.


These products help maintain a glowing complexion with minimal effort.


Where to Shop for Skin Care in Seoul


Seoul offers many places to shop for skin care, from large department stores to small boutiques:


  • Myeongdong Shopping Street: Packed with flagship stores of popular K-Beauty brands, perfect for trying samples and getting advice.

  • Olive Young: A drugstore chain with a wide selection of skin care products at various price points.

  • Dongdaemun Market: Great for finding trendy and affordable skin care items.

  • Sinsa-dong Garosu-gil: Boutique stores with indie and luxury Korean brands.

  • Mega Select Pharmacy in Gangnam : Health products and affordable effective skincare.


Exploring these areas lets you discover new favorites and enjoy the vibrant beauty culture.


Tips for Buying Skin Care Products in Seoul


  • Test products when possible: Many stores offer testers so you can check texture and scent.

  • Check ingredient lists: If you have sensitive skin, look for gentle, non-irritating ingredients.

  • Ask for samples: Staff often provide samples to help you try products before committing.

  • Consider your skin type: Seoul’s products cater to all skin types, so choose what suits your needs.

  • Watch for travel-friendly sizes: Many brands offer mini versions perfect for carrying home.


These tips help you shop smart and bring home products that work well for you.
